Northrop grumman set to launch 12th cargo delivery mission to the international space station for nasa

Northrop grumman corporation is set to launch the company's antarestm rocket carrying its cygnustm cargo spacecraft to the international space station for nasa. pending completion of cargo late load and acceptable local weather conditions, the launch will take place nov. 2, with lift-off scheduled for 9:59 a.m. edt from the mid-atlantic regional spaceport pad 0a on wallops island, virginia, at nasa's wallops flight facility. northrop grumman's antares rocket and cygnus spacecraft are set to launch the company's 12th cargo delivery mission to the international space station. scheduled to rendezvous and berth with the station on nov. 4, 2019, ng-12 marks the 12th cygnus mission to deliver cargo to the iss and the first launch under the company's commercial resupply services-2 (crs-2) contract. ng-12 will be the heaviest load carried by both cygnus and antares with approximately 8,200 pounds (3,729 kilograms) of cargo for the station. the rocket's 230+ version will be used for this mission which includes upgrades to the stage 1 core, lighter composite structures and an optimized second stage motor. the upgraded stage 1 core allows the antares engines to perform at full thrust throughout most of the first stage flight profile. on this mission, cygnus will undergo a late load of critical cargo 24 hours before the scheduled launch. this capability allows time-sensitive payloads, such as the live rodents flying on cygnus, to be safely transported to the space station. earlier this year, northrop grumman began providing science facilities for nasa to support rodent research at the eastern virginia medical school in norfolk, virginia. a key flexibility feature added for crs-2 is the ability for nasa to significantly alter the final cargo load by up to 20% as late as 24 hours before lift off. another new capability that will be demonstrated during this mission is the simultaneous operation of two cygnus spacecraft in orbit. the ng-12 mission will be in orbit at the same time as the ng-11 cygnus spacecraft, which launched in april 2019 on an extended duration flight. the ability to fly two vehicles at once further demonstrates the robustness of cygnus to support the goals of nasa's ambitious missions.
